- the machining tool engages in the substrate to be processed.
- high machining forces are transmitted and derived from the bit holder in the base part.
- the force direction and also the amount itself varies under otherwise identical conditions, solely due to the fact that the machining tool forms a chip (commaspan) thickening from the entry point to the exit point.
- the direction of force and the amount varies depending on various parameters, such as the milling depth, the feed, the material to be processed, etc.

- the bit holders are usually arranged in a projecting manner on the surface of a milling drum tube.
- the support body has a further removal surface which is at an angle to the two removal surfaces of the Abtrag vomplanes.
- three removal surfaces are provided on the bit holder, which are used for load transfer into the base part.
- the three ablation surfaces are at an angle to each other and thus, similar to a pyramid with a triangular base, a three-sided support. This support guarantees a tight fit of the chisel holder on the base part even with changing direction of the machining force.
- a relief of the plug-in projection is caused by the three wear surfaces.
- one or more additional removal surfaces can also be added to the three removal surfaces in order to attach the bit holder to adapt a specific work task. For example, it is also possible to use four support surfaces, which are all in mutual control of one another.
- the two removal surfaces of the Abtrag vomcos are arranged at least partially in the feed direction of the chisel holder before the plug approach and another Abtragfiumblee against the feed direction behind the plug approach.
- the two removal surfaces of the Abtrag vomcos opposite to the feed direction at least partially behind the plug approach and another Abtragfiumblee in the feed direction is at least partially disposed in front of the insertion approach.
- a load-optimized construction results from the fact that the two removal surfaces of the Abtrag vomcos and the at least one further Abtragfiambae diverge from the insertion side towards the processing side.
- the divergent removal surfaces also form a prism-shaped support in the region of the insertion side and allow a reliable removal of force to the outside.
- a particularly preferred embodiment of the invention provides that the at least one further removal surface is formed substantially symmetrically to the central transverse plane running in the direction of the central longitudinal axis of the insertion projection , Characterized in that the bit holder is designed symmetrically at its coming into contact with the base part surface areas of the Abtrag vom, equal load conditions are achieved in the different mounting positions.
- a further removal surface forms the underside of a front apron of the chisel holder.
- the front apron usually covers a front portion of the base part and thus protects it against wear. The fact that now the front apron is also used for attaching the erosion surface, resulting in a compact design and it can be easily made the bit holder.
- a further removal surface at least partially forms the underside of a rear support lug. Under certain operating conditions, a large part of the forces is transmitted via the rear support lug. The level further removal surface offers reliable support here.
- the removal surfaces of the removal surface pair and the further removal surface can form a trihedral support guide. Accordingly, the three removal surfaces form a pyramid with a triangular base as a support guide.
- the surface normals of the abrading surfaces of the abrading surface pair are in each case aligned with their pointing tool feed seen chisel holder side. Accordingly, therefore, the Abtrag lake the Abtrag vomoomes are arranged, for example, when using the bit holder on a Fräswalzenrohr inclined to the axis of rotation of the Fräswalzenrohres. By this arrangement, the lateral forces can be reliably derived.
